An arizona-born poet whose works include Margaret & Dusty: Poems, Mysteries of Small Houses, and Grave of Light. For her 2001 collection, Disobedience, she received the International Griffin Poetry Prize. Alice Notley was born on November 8, 1945 in Arizona. Susan Howe is another prominent female poet. She graduated from Barnard College and subsequently received her M.F.A. from the famed Iowa Writers’ Workshop.
